We’ve covered the launch of Titici’s handmade-in-Italy Alloi aluminum gravel bike last spring.
![Titici Alloi AND aluminum gravel bike with GHA Silver hard anodized finish, complete bike](https://bikerumor.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/02/Titici-Alloi-AND-comfy-aluminum-gravel-bike-with-GHA-Silver-hard-anodized-finish_complete-bike.jpg)
An update to their old round-tube All-In, the Alloi added the framebuilder’s signature flattened PAT toptube design for additional rider comfort. The Plate Absorber Tech – new Hydroformed edition (PAT.H), is not quite as flat as in carbon. But Titici claims the comfort gains are still a big help, especially over long days in the saddle off-road. Plus, the alloy PAT.H frameset sells for about half of the carbon PAT version in their Relli.
Now that bike adds the optional AND finish debuted on the old All-In AND a year earlier. A look that truly sets the bike apart, while also boosting frame protection.
GHA Silver Ano – Tech Details
![Titici Alloi AND aluminum gravel bike with GHA Silver hard anodized finish, integrated internal cable routing](https://bikerumor.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/02/Titici-Alloi-AND-comfy-aluminum-gravel-bike-with-GHA-Silver-hard-anodized-finish_integrated-internal-routing.jpg)
Developed with alloy tubing supplier Dedacciai, the purpose of the GHA (Golden Hard Anodizing) process is actually to better protect the aluminum frame – both inside and out. The name is a bit confusing reflecting the final coloring. But the process works by integrating a protective oxide layer of silver ions onto the porous surface of the aluminum tubes. Delivering “almost infinite durability”.
The result is increased hardness & resistance to wear, but also a lower friction surface, and high antibacterial & anti-mold performance. That’s why GHA has long been in use for marine & pharmaceutical industries. Titici says they have an exclusive partnership with the Japanese creators of the technology, making this the only GHA bike you can get.
Rumor has it, that mud & dirt are noticeably easier to wipe right off after a ride. Cool.
![Titici Alloi AND aluminum gravel bike with GHA Silver hard anodized finish, threaded bottom bracket](https://bikerumor.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/02/Titici-Alloi-AND-comfy-aluminum-gravel-bike-with-GHA-Silver-hard-anodized-finish_BSA-threaded-bottom-bracket-detail.jpg)
Another side benefit is that the unique anodization process tints the different tubes and welds differently, giving the aluminum bike a varied gold-to-bronze color that actually reminds me of a raw fillet brazed steel frame.
All that, and it’s lighter than paint, too!
What else is new?
![Titici Alloi AND aluminum gravel bike with GHA Silver hard anodized finish, seatstay detail](https://bikerumor.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/02/Titici-Alloi-AND-comfy-aluminum-gravel-bike-with-GHA-Silver-hard-anodized-finish_seatstay-detail.jpg)
![Titici Alloi AND aluminum gravel bike with GHA Silver hard anodized finish, INGRID CRS-POP crankset](https://bikerumor.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/02/Titici-Alloi-AND-comfy-aluminum-gravel-bike-with-GHA-Silver-hard-anodized-finish_BB-and-IngRid-Pop-crankset.jpg)
The big functional update to the Alloi frame is increased tire clearance. Titici says this new generation of Alloi AND gravel frames now has room for up to 700 x 45mm or 650 x 50mm tires. No word on what exact changes were made. But a quick look at new and old frames suggests a likely subtle chainstay tweak to squeeze an extra 5mm.
The bonus good news, the tire clearance upgrade also applies to the standard painted Alloi this year, too.
Alloi Bike Details
![Titici Alloi AND aluminum gravel bike with GHA Silver hard anodized finish, driveside dropout](https://bikerumor.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/02/Titici-Alloi-AND-comfy-aluminum-gravel-bike-with-GHA-Silver-hard-anodized-finish_rear-dropout-detail.jpg)
![Titici Alloi AND aluminum gravel bike with GHA Silver hard anodized finish, flat mount dic brakes](https://bikerumor.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/02/Titici-Alloi-AND-comfy-aluminum-gravel-bike-with-GHA-Silver-hard-anodized-finish_flat-mount-disc-brake-detail.jpg)
Briefly, the Titici Alloi is a 1690g 7000-series Dedacciai aluminum gravel frame with fully internal cable routing through a 1.5″ Deda DCR headset system, a threaded BSA BB, 31.6mm seatpost, flat mount disc & 12mm thru-axles. It is compatible with 1x or 2x drivetrains – mechanical or electronic. The bike has custom-shaped alloy tubes and a flexy PAT.H toptube for off-road comfort.
![Titici Alloi AND aluminum gravel bike with GHA Silver hard anodized finish, angled rear](https://bikerumor.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/02/2024-Titici-Alloi-AND-comfortable-aluminum-gravel-bike-with-GHA-Silver-hard-anodized-finish_angled-rear.jpg)
It features 2 sets of front triangle bottle bosses, a toptube bag mount & a rear rack mount. And it is sold with a full carbon fork with 3-pack Anything cage mounts.
![2024 Titici Alloi AND comfortable aluminum gravel bike with GHA Silver hard anodized finish, stock geometry](https://bikerumor.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/02/2024-Titici-Alloi-AND-comfortable-aluminum-gravel-bike-with-GHA-Silver-hard-anodized-finish_stock-geometry.jpg)
The Alloi comes in 4 stock sizes (S-XL). And I believe custom geometry is also possible for an upcharge.
Titici Alloi AND in silver ano – Pricing, options & availability
![2024 Titici Alloi AND comfortable aluminum gravel bike with GHA Silver hard anodized finish, frameset](https://bikerumor.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/02/2024-Titici-Alloi-AND-comfortable-aluminum-gravel-bike-with-GHA-Silver-hard-anodized-finish_frameset.jpg)
The new Titici Alloi AND frameset is available on its own with stock geometry for 2590€. That’s now only a 200€ upcharge over the standard painted edition. To highlight the made-in-Italy alloy nature of the new bike, Titici partnered with Ingrid components for a limited edition complete build of the new bike.
![2024 Titici Alloi AND X Ingrid LE, comfortable aluminum gravel bike with GHA Silver hard anodized finish, good dog](https://bikerumor.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/02/2024-Titici-Alloi-AND-comfortable-aluminum-gravel-bike-with-GHA-Silver-hard-anodized-finish_Titici-Alloi-AND-X-Ingrid-LE-complete_Nebbia-is-a-good-dog.jpg)
The Titici Alloi AND X Ingrid LE complete bike sells for 5690€, with a set of matching gold ano Ingrid CRS-POP cranks and a Ingrid 11-44T cassette. That then pairs with a SRAM Rival XPLR AXS groupset. And a mix of Italian company components – Fulcrum Rapid Red 900 alloy wheels with Pirelli Cinturato H tires, and an integrated Deda aluminum finishing kit. Titici claims a complete bike weight of 9.3kg.
Then newly anodized frames are in stock and ready to deliver now. They build complete bikes to order, with an approximate 2 week lead-time before delivery through your local Titici dealer.
